Claims
- 1. A process for the preparation of a powdered stabilizer mixture comprising tin stabilizers and adsorbents, which process consists essentially of mixing and heating to a temperature between 40.degree. and 120.degree. C. at least one carboxylic acid or carboxylic anhydride, at least one organotin oxide and at least one adsorbent selected from the group consisting of silicic acids, diatomaceous earth, silicates, clay minerals, activated aluminas and particulate organic polymers.
- 2. A process according to claim 1, wherein the carboxylic acid component is a compound of formula I
- R.sub.1 --COOH (I),
- wherein R.sub.1 is --H, alkyl of 1 to 18 carbon atoms, alkenyl of 2 to 18 carbon atoms, a --COOH or --R.sub.2 --COOH radical, wherein R.sub.2 is --CH.dbd.CH--, alkylene of 1 to 4 carbon atoms, phenylene or phenylene which is substituted by C.sub.1 -C.sub.4 alkyl, or is --CH.sub.2 --CH(OH)--, or R.sub.1 is a --CH(XH)--CH.sub.3 radical, wherein X=O or S, or R.sub.1 is a --CR.sub.3 R.sub.4 --(CR.sub.5 R.sub.6).sub.n --SH radical, wherein R.sub.3, R.sub.4, R.sub.5 and R.sub.6 are each independently of one another --H or alkyl of 1 to 6 carbon atoms, and n is 0 or 1, or R.sub.1 is a radical ##STR9## or R.sub.1 is phenyl or phenyl which is substituted by C.sub.1 -C.sub.6 alkyl and/or OH, or is phenyl-C.sub.1 -C.sub.4 alkyl or phenyl-C.sub.1 -C.sub.4 alkyl which is substituted in the phenyl moiety by C.sub.1 -C.sub.6 alkyl and/or OH, or an anhydride thereof.
- 3. A process according to claim 1, wherein the carboxylic acid component is a compound of formula I, wherein R.sub.1 is alkyl of 12 to 18 carbon atoms, or wherein R.sub.1 is a --COOH or --R.sub.2 --COOH radical, wherein R.sub.2 is --CH.dbd.CH--, alkylene of 1 to 4 carbon atoms or --CH.sub.2 --CH(OH)--, or wherein R.sub.1 is a --CH(SH)--CH.sub.3 or --CH(OH)--CH.sub.3 radical, or R.sub.1 is a --CH.sub.2 --SH or --CH.sub.2 --CH.sub.2 --SH radical, or R.sub.1 is a radical ##STR10## or an anhydride thereof or a mixture of such carboxylic acids or/an anhydrides.
- 4. A process according to claim 1, wherein the carboxylic acid or anhydride is selected from thioglycolic acid, 3-mercaptopropionic acid, thiosalicylic acid, maleic acid, maleic anhydride or a mixture thereof.
- 5. A process according to claim 1, wherein the organotin oxide is a compound of formula II ##STR11## wherein R.sub.7 and R.sub.8 are each independently of the other C.sub.1 -C.sub.20 alkyl, C.sub.6 -C.sub.20 alkoxycarbonylalkyl, C.sub.7 -C.sub.9 phenylalkyl, phenyl or C.sub.1 -C.sub.4 alkyl-substituted phenyl.
- 6. A process according to claim 5, wherein the organotin oxide is a compound of formula II, wherein R.sub.7 and R.sub.8 are alkyl of 1 to 18 carbon atoms.
- 7. A process according to claim 5, wherein the organotin oxide is a compound of formula II, wherein R.sub.7 and R.sub.8 are identical and are alkyl of 4 to 12 carbon atoms.
- 8. A process according to claim 1, wherein the adsorbent contains an alkali metal oxide or an alkaline earth metal oxide or an oxide of the metals Al, Ti, Zr, Fe, Co or Ni or a mixture of these oxides.
- 9. A process according to claim 1, wherein the carboxylic acid or carboxylic anhydride and the organotin oxide is mixed with the adsorbent such that the mixture always remains free-flowing.
- 10. A process according to claim 1, wherein the carboxylic acid or carboxylic anhydride, the organotin oxide and the adsorbent are heated under normal pressure to temperatures in the range of up to 120.degree. C. or under vacuum to temperatures of up to 100.degree. C.
- 11. A process according to claim 1, wherein the carboxylic acid or carboxylic anhydride is used in 0.95- to 1.05-fold equivalent amount, based on the organotin oxide.
- 12. A process according to claim 1, wherein the amount of adsorbent in the stabilizer mixture is 5 to 95% by weight.
- 13. A process according to claim 1, wherein the mixture additionally contains a further stabilizer.
- 14. A process according to claim 13 wherein the further stabilizer is a phenolic antioxidant.
